### function ###
function Toggle-TamperProtection {
param (
## hostname ##
[Parameter(Mandatory=$false,ValueFromPipeline=$true)]
[string]
$computerName
,
[Parameter(Mandatory=$false)]
[string]
$csv
,
[Parameter(Mandatory=$false)]
[string]
$all
,
[Parameter(Mandatory=$false)]
[switch]
$enable
,
[Parameter(Mandatory=$false)]
[switch]
$disable
)
$sophosApiResponse = Authenticate-SophosApi
if ($disable) {
$promptUserMessage = "disabling"
$json = @{"enabled" = "false"} | ConvertTo-Json
}
elseIf ($enable) {
$promptUserMessage = "enabling"
$json = @{"enabled" = "true"} | ConvertTo-Json
}
else {
Write-Host "[ERROR] please supply -enable or -disable flags when toggling tamper protection"
return
}
if ($all) {
$promptUser = Read-Host "$($promptUserMessage) + tamper protection from all devices. Press 'y' to continue."
if($promptUser -eq 'y') {
$endpoints = Get-SophosEndpoints -sophosApiResponse $sophosApiResponse
foreach ($endpoint in $endpoints) {
$endpointId = $endpoint.id
# build the uri for removing tamper protection from the specified $ComputerName (requires the $endpointId)
$uri = ($sophosApiResponse['dataRegionApiUri'] + "/endpoint/v1/endpoints/" + $endpointId + "/tamper-protection")
try {
# api request to toggle tamper protection
$tamperProtectionToggleResponse = Invoke-RestMethod -Method Post -Headers @{Authorization="Bearer $($sophosApiResponse['token_resp'].access_token)"; "X-Tenant-ID"=$sophosApiResponse['whoami_resp'].id} -ContentType "application/json" -Body $json -Uri $uri
Write-Host "$($promptUserMessage) tamper protection on device: $($endpoint.hosts)"
Start-Sleep -Milliseconds 250
}
catch {
Write-Warning "Failed to toggle tamper protection for device: $($endpoint.hosts) with id: $($endpointId)"
Write-Warning $Error[0]
}
}
}
else {
Write-Host "exiting..."
return
}
}
if ($csv) {
$endpointsCsv = Import-SophosEndpointHostList -csv $csv
$sophosEndpoints = Get-SophosEndpoints -sophosApiResponse $sophosApiResponse
foreach ($endpoint in $endpointsCsv) {
#Write-Host $endpoint.hosts
$endpointId = Get-SophosEndpointId -computerName $endpoint.hosts -sophosApiResponse $sophosApiResponse -sophosEndpoints $sophosEndpoints
# build the uri for removing tamper protection from the specified $ComputerName (requires the $endpointId)
$uri = ($sophosApiResponse['dataRegionApiUri'] + "/endpoint/v1/endpoints/" + $endpointId + "/tamper-protection")
try {
# api request to toggle tamper protection
$tamperProtectionToggleResponse = Invoke-RestMethod -Method Post -Headers @{Authorization="Bearer $($sophosApiResponse['token_resp'].access_token)"; "X-Tenant-ID"=$sophosApiResponse['whoami_resp'].id} -ContentType "application/json" -Body $json -Uri $uri
Write-Host "$($promptUserMessage) tamper protection on device: $($endpoint.hosts)"
Start-Sleep -Milliseconds 250
}
catch {
Write-Warning "Failed to toggle tamper protection for device: $($endpoint.hosts) with id: $($endpointId)"
Write-Warning $Error[0]
}
}
}
elseIf ($computerName) {
# get the associated endpointId for the specified $ComputerName
$endpointId = Get-SophosEndpointId $computerName
if ($endpointId -eq $null) {
return
}
# build the uri for removing tamper protection from the specified $ComputerName (requires the $endpointId)
$uri = ($sophosApiResponse['dataRegionApiUri'] + "/endpoint/v1/endpoints/" + $endpointId + "/tamper-protection")
# api request to remove tamper protection
try {
$tamperProtectionToggleResponse = Invoke-RestMethod -Method Post -Headers @{Authorization="Bearer $($sophosApiResponse['token_resp'].access_token)"; "X-Tenant-ID"=$sophosApiResponse['whoami_resp'].id} -Uri $uri -ContentType "application/json" -Body $json
}
catch {
Write-Warning "Failed to toggle tamper protection for device: $($computerName) with id: $($endpointId)"
Write-Warning $Error[0]
}
Write-Host "$($promptUserMessage) tamper protection on device: $($computerName)"
}
else {
Write-Host "no endpoints specified"
return
}
}
### function ###
function Get-SophosEndpoints {
param (
[Parameter(Mandatory=$false)]
$sophosApiResponse
,
[Parameter(Mandatory=$false)]
[switch]
$export
)
if (!($sophosApiResponse)) {
$sophosApiResponse = Authenticate-SophosApi
}
#Write-Host "token response is: $($sophosApiResponse["token_resp"].access_token)"
#Write-Host "whoami response: $($sophosApiResponse["whoami_resp"].id)"
#Write-Host "data region uri: $($sophosApiResponse["dataRegionApiUri"])"
$endpoint_key = $sophosApiResponse["endpoints_resp"].pages.nextKey
$sophosEndpoints = @()
$sophosEndpoints_noDupes = @()
Write-Host "grabbing updated list of endpoints from sophos api..."
Do {
#Write-Host $endpoint_key
$endpoints_resp = Invoke-RestMethod -Method Get -Headers @{Authorization="Bearer $($sophosApiResponse["token_resp"].access_token)"; "X-Tenant-ID"=$sophosApiResponse["whoami_resp"].id} ($($sophosApiResponse["dataRegionApiUri"])+"/endpoint/v1/endpoints?pageSize=500&pageTotal=true&pageFromKey=$($endpoint_key)")
# enumerate results and append to csv
$sophosEndpoints += @($endpoints_resp.items |
Select-Object -Property id,type,hostname,health,os,
@{name="ipv4Addresses"; expression={$_.ipv4Addresses | select -First 1}},
@{name="ipv6Addresses"; expression={$_.ipv6Addresses | Select -First 1}},
@{name="macAddresses"; expression={$_.macAddresses | Select -First 1}},
associatedPerson,tamperProtectionEnabled,
@{name="endpointProtection"; expression={$_.assignedProducts[0] | Where-Object -Property code -eq -Value "endpointProtection"}},
@{name="interceptX"; expression={$_.assignedProducts[1] | Where-Object -Property code -eq -Value "interceptX"}},
@{name="coreAgent"; expression={$_.assignedProducts[2] | Where-Object -Property code -eq -Value "coreAgent"}},
lastSeenAt)
#Write-Host $endpoints_resp.items
Start-Sleep -Seconds 2
$endpoint_key = $endpoints_resp.pages.nextKey
}
While ($endpoints_resp.pages.fromKey -ne "")
##----##
## remove duplicate devices ##
Write-Host "removing duplicates...."
# sort the endpoints using the "lastSeenAt" property descending and then group endpoints with the same hostname
$endpoints_grouped_duplicates_sorted = $sophosEndpoints | Sort-Object {$_."lastSeenAt" -as [datetime]} -Descending | Group-Object "hostname"
ForEach ($endpoint_group in $endpoints_grouped_duplicates_sorted) {
# expand group of duplicate endpoint objects
$duplicates = Select-Object -InputObject $endpoint_group -ExpandProperty "Group"
# select the unique endpoint from the duplicates
$unique_endpoint = $duplicates | select -First 1
$sophosEndpoints_noDupes += $unique_endpoint
}
if ($export) {
$sophosEndpoints_noDupes = $sophosEndpoints_noDupes | Export-Csv -Path .\endpoints.csv -NoTypeInformation -Encoding UTF8
} else {
$sophosEndpoints_noDupes = $sophosEndpoints_noDupes | sort "hostname"
}
return $sophosEndpoints_noDupes
}

function Authenticate-SophosApi {
try {
$apiCredentials = Read-Host "Enter path to sophos api credentials file (\path\to\filename.json)"
$apiCredentials = Get-Content $apiCredentials | ConvertFrom-Json
} catch {
Write-Error "[ERROR] api credential file not found or is formatted improperly"
}
$client_id = $apiCredentials.client_id
$client_secret = $apiCredentials.client_secret
$sophosApiResponse = @{}
Write-Host "Authenticating with Sophos API...."
# authenticate with sophos (returns time/scope limited java web token)
$token_resp = Invoke-RestMethod -Method Post -ContentType "application/x-www-form-urlencoded" -Body "grant_type=client_credentials&client_id=$client_id&client_secret=$client_secret&scope=token" -Uri https://id.sophos.com/api/v2/oauth2/token
$whoami_resp = Invoke-RestMethod -Method Get -Headers @{Authorization="Bearer $($token_resp.access_token)"} https://api.central.sophos.com/whoami/v1
$dataRegionApiUri = $whoami_resp.apiHosts.dataRegion
# Get all endpoints within the tenant
$endpoints_resp = Invoke-RestMethod -Method Get -Headers @{Authorization="Bearer $($token_resp.access_token)"; "X-Tenant-ID"=$whoami_resp.id} ($($whoami_resp.apiHosts.dataRegion)+"/endpoint/v1/endpoints")
$sophosApiResponse["token_resp"] = $token_resp
$sophosApiResponse["whoami_resp"] = $whoami_resp
$sophosApiResponse["endpoints_resp"] = $endpoints_resp
$sophosApiResponse["dataRegionApiUri"] = $dataRegionApiUri
return $sophosApiResponse
}

function Check-TamperProtectionStatus {
Param (
[Parameter(Mandatory=$false)]
[string]
$csv
,
[Parameter(Mandatory=$false,ValueFromPipeline=$true)]
[String]
$computerName
,
[Parameter(Mandatory=$false)]
$sophosApiResponse
,
[Parameter(Mandatory=$false)]
$sophosEndpoints
)
$sophosApiResponse = Authenticate-SophosApi
$sophosEndpoints = Get-SophosEndpoints -sophosApiResponse $sophosApiResponse
if($csv) {
$hostListCsv = Import-SophosEndpointHostList -csv $csv
ForEach ($hostname in $hostListCsv) {
ForEach ($endpoint in $sophosEndpoints) {
$tamperProtectionEnabled = [bool]::Parse($endpoint.tamperProtectionEnabled)
#Write-Host $endpoint.hostname
#Write-Host $hostname.hosts
if($endpoint.hostname -eq $hostname.hosts -And $tamperProtectionEnabled -eq $false) {
Write-Host "Tamper Protection is DISABLED for $($hostname.hosts)"
}
elseif ($endpoint.hostname -eq $hostname.hosts -And $tamperProtectionEnabled -eq $true) {
Write-Host "Tamper Protection is ENABLED for $($hostname.hosts)"
}
}
}
}
elseif($computerName) {
ForEach ($endpoint in $sophosEndpoints) {
$tamperProtectionEnabled = [bool]::Parse($endpoint.tamperProtectionEnabled)
#Write-Host $endpoint.hostname
#Write-Host $hostname.hosts
if($endpoint.hostname -eq $computerName -And $tamperProtectionEnabled -eq $false) {
Write-Host "Tamper Protection is DISABLED for $($computerName)"
}
elseif ($endpoint.hostname -eq $computerName -And $tamperProtectionEnabled -eq $true) {
Write-Host "Tamper Protection is ENABLED for $($computerName)"
}
}
}
else {
Write-Error "missing computerName or csv"
}
}
